BRASILIA, June 30 – Cases of COVID-19 could also be declining in North America however in most of Latin America and the Caribbean the end to the coronavirus pandemic “remains a distant future”, the Pan American Health Organization (PAHO) mentioned on Wednesday.

While infections in the United States, Canada and Mexico are falling, in Latin America and the Caribbean cases are rising and vaccination is lagging badly. Only one in ten folks have been absolutely vaccinated, which PAHO director Carissa Etienne known as “an unacceptable situation.”

“While we are seeing some reprieve from the virus in countries in the Northern Hemisphere, for most countries in our region, the end remains a distant future,” she mentioned.

The regional well being company discouraged summer time vacation journey in the Americas now that motion restrictions are being lifted as extra individuals are vaccinated in the Northern Hemisphere and journey locations, such because the Caribbean, reopen for vacationers.

Even individuals who have been vaccinated can grow to be sick and unfold COVID, Etienne mentioned in a weekly briefing.

“Given the significant gaps in vaccine coverage and the still imminent risk of infection, now may not be the ideal time for travel – especially in places with active outbreaks or where hospital capacity may be limited,” she mentioned.

Noting that the hurricane season in the Caribbean is arriving at a time when outbreaks are worsening, Etienne urged nations to outfit hospitals and broaden shelters to scale back the potential for transmission. Social distancing and correct air flow grow to be tough throughout storms, she mentioned.

The extremely transmissible Delta variant has already been detected in a dozen nations in the Americas, however to date group transmission has been restricted, mentioned PAHO viral illness advisor Jairo Mendez.

However, it has been discovered in Argentina, Brazil, Canada, Chile, Peru, the United States and Mexico, the place it has unfold in Mexico City, in keeping with PAHO.

Given the presence of such variants, nations in the area ought to step up vigilance and take into account the necessity to restrict journey and even shut borders, PAHO well being emergencies director Ciro Ugarte mentioned.

According to a Reuters tally, there have been a minimum of 37,441,000 reported infections and 1,272,000 confirmed deaths brought on by COVID-19 in Latin America and the Caribbean to date, one third greater than in Asia and Africa mixed.
